How much do global product j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for global product in the United States is $159,405.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$141,000.00 and $197,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the typical challenges faced by professionals in a global product role,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Global Product roles often navigate challenges such as managing diverse stakeholder expectations across regions, adapting products for different markets, and coordinating with cross-functional teams across time zones. Success in this role requires strong communication skills, cultural sensitivity, and the ability to prioritize features based on global and local market needs. Building robust processes for feedback, maintaining transparency, and leveraging collaborative project management tools can help address these challenges effectively.

What is a global product manager?

A Global Product Manager is responsible for overseeing the development, launch, and lifecycle of a product across multiple international markets. They coordinate with regional teams to ensure the product meets the needs of diverse customers, while maintaining consistency with the company’s overall strategy and brand. Global Product Managers also analyze market trends, adapt products for local requirements, and work closely with cross-functional teams such as marketing, sales, and engineering.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a global product manager?

To thrive as a Global Product Manager, you need strong analytical skills, market research expertise, and a background in business, marketing, or a related field, often sup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with product management tools (such as Jira or Trello), data analytics platforms, and experience with global product lifecycle management are typically required. Outstanding cross-cultural communication, leadership, and adaptability help you collaborate with diverse international teams and stakeholders. These skills are crucial for successfully launching and managing products across global markets, ensuring alignment with organizational strategy and customer needs.

Summary:

The Brecknell Scales Global Product Manager owns the full product lifecycle and global strategy for the Brecknell Scales portfolio (with additional Salter and AWTX branded products). This is a hands-on role that blends strategic product management with technical sales support and supplier relationship management.

Brecknell focuses on affordable, easy-to-use, competitively priced scales primarily sourced from China (approx. 80% of volume). Key markets include medical, veterinary, food service/POS, postal/mail/shipping, and sports fishing. The role drives revenue growth, maintains strong margins where possible through unique/owned designs, mitigates risks from market saturation and direct-from-China competition, and ensures products remain simple, compliant, and low-maintenance to minimize technical support calls.
